This Week Around the World

June 29 Addis Ababa, Ethiopia: Popular musician, activist and former political prisoner Hachalu Hundessa was shot and killed in Ethiopia’s capital city of Addis Ababa. “I express my deep condolences…

This Week Around the World

May 25 Mexico City, Mexico: Archaeologists discovered the remains of at least 60 mammoths, including fully grown males and females as well as their young, near the construction site of…